About Us

Kingdom Support and Care CIC (KSC) is a Community Interest Company, a private company limited by shares and a wholly owned subsidiary of Kingdom Housing Association (KHA). We are accredited Gold in Investors in People and a Living Wage Scotland employer.

KSC supports over 300 people throughout Fife and Falkirk, providing high quality and personalised support and care designed to meet individual needs and desired outcomes.

We provide support to people with a range of needs in their own homes, including those with: learning disability, autistic spectrum disorder, complex needs, mental health issues, age related needs, homelessness, drug and alcohol addictions.

The support and care provided by KSC is flexible, responsive and person centred support which assists people to live their lives as they wish and to enable them to meet their desired outcomes.
